MGI Phenotype |
F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es a member of the protein inhibitor of activated STAT (PIAS) family. PIAS proteins function as SUMO E3 ligases and play important roles in many cellular processes by mediating the sumoylation of target proteins. This protein plays a central role as a transcriptional coregulator of numerous cellular pathways includign the STAT1 and nuclear factor kappaB pathways. Alternate splicing results in multiple transcript variants. [provided by RefSeq, Mar 2016] PHENOTYPE: Homozygous null mice display partial perinatal lethality, reduced body size, decreased susceptibility to viral infection, and increased susceptibility to bacterial infection and LPS-induced endotoxin shock. [provided by MGI curators]
